You either have the firing order wrong or the timing is not set right. You get fire out of the intake when a spark plug fires when an intake valve is still open. Order is 18436572 cylinders are 1357 front to back on drivers side, 2468 on passenger side. Turn the engine so the mark on the crank points to "0" on the timing scale. Set the distributor so the rotor points towards the front of the engine (not exactly but not at the firewall) If when at "0" it points to fw, turn one more time. Set wires on cap with #1 aligned with the rotor, then all others in order clockwise.
Only other possibility is that you have the valves adjusted too tight, have a bad cap or rotor or the replacement engine has a burned valve (doubt it).
